Default LS1Edit & HP Tuners Compatiable

Does anyone know if LS1Edit can read the PCM that is programmed with HP Tuners? I am hearing mixed answers. Currently my car is getting tuned with a HP 2-bar program. I have a copy of LS1Edit and I was wondering if I can still use it. I have heard yes and no on this one.

If it's a HPT custom OS, then no, no other software will be able to open or modify the tune.

I have had issues from edit to an hp file...I have had tables not copy completely(dtc tables...2/3 missing) and odd translations in the ve and pe tables on one car. I have never had an issue going the other way but it still scares me that maybe something changed that I didn't see.

Originally Posted by Y2Kvert4me
If it's a HPT custom OS, then no, no other software will be able to open or modify the tune.


Exactly, and since you said it was going to be a 2-bar custom OS, then your LS1 Edit will not be able to read or change the tune.
